亚马逊VPS80端口开启方法_详细步骤指南

亚马逊VPS的80端口如何开启?

步骤 操作说明 注意事项
1 登录亚马逊AWS控制台 确保使用管理员账户
2 进入EC2实例管理页面 选择目标VPS实例
3 配置安全组规则 添加入站规则允许80端口
4 保存并应用设置 可能需要短暂重启服务

亚马逊VPS80端口开启方法

在亚马逊VPS上开启80端口是部署Web服务的常见需求。本文将详细介绍通过AWS控制台配置安全组规则、开放80端口的完整流程,并解答相关常见问题。

安全组配置步骤

安全组是亚马逊VPS的虚拟防火墙,控制着入站和出站流量。要开启80端口,需要修改安全组规则:
  1. 登录AWS控制台,进入EC2服务页面
  2. 在左侧导航栏选择"安全组"
  3. 点击目标安全组,选择"入站规则"选项卡
  4. 点击"编辑规则"按钮
  5. 添加新规则:
  • 类型选择"HTTP(80)"
  • 源设置为"0.0.0.0/0"允许所有IP访问
  • 或指定特定IP段提高安全性
  1. 点击"保存规则"完成配置

验证端口状态

配置完成后,可以通过以下方法验证80端口是否成功开启:
  • 使用telnet命令:telnet [实例公有DNS] 80
  • 通过在线端口检测工具
  • 在实例内部运行:netstat -tuln | grep 80
注意:如果使用自定义端口,需要在安全组中添加对应的规则。

常见问题解答

1. 配置后仍无法访问80端口? 检查实例是否运行了Web服务(如Apache/Nginx),并确认服务监听的是0.0.0.0地址而非127.0.0.1。 2. 如何提高80端口的安全性? 建议:
  • 限制源IP范围而非使用0.0.0.0/0
  • 配合WAF(Web应用防火墙)使用
  • 定期检查安全组规则
3. 80端口开启会影响性能吗? 端口本身不会影响性能,但需注意:
  • 确保实例类型能承受预期流量
  • 监控CPU和内存使用情况
  • 考虑使用负载均衡分担流量
通过以上步骤,您可以安全地在亚马逊VPS上开启80端口,为Web服务提供访问通道。根据实际需求调整安全组规则,在便利性和安全性之间取得平衡。

发表评论

评论列表